Safety Information

Please read all of the safety information carefully before using your device to ensure its safe and proper operation and to learn how to dispose of your device properly.

Operation and safety

  • To prevent possible hearing damage, do not listen at high volume levels for long periods.
  • Using an unapproved or incompatible power adapter, charger, or battery may damage your device, shorten its lifespan, or cause a fire, explosion, or other hazards.
  • Ideal operating temperatures are 0°C to 35°C. Ideal storage temperatures are –20°C to +45°C.
  • Pacemaker manufacturers recommend that a minimum distance of 15 cm be maintained between a device and a pacemaker to prevent potential interference with the pacemaker. If using a pacemaker, hold the device on the side opposite the pacemaker and do not carry the device in your front pocket.
  • Keep the device and the battery away from excessive heat and direct sunlight. Do not place them on or in heating devices, such as microwave ovens, stoves, or radiators.
  • Observe local laws and regulations while using the device. To reduce the risk of accidents, do not use your wireless device while driving.
  • While flying in an aircraft or immediately before boarding, only use your device according to the instructions provided. The use of a wireless device in an aircraft may disrupt wireless networks, present a hazard to aircraft operation, or be illegal.
  • In order to avoid damaging the internal circuit of the device or charger, do not use the device in a dusty, damp, or dirty place, or near a magnetic field.
  • When charging the device, make sure the power adapter is plugged into a socket near the device and is easily accessible.
  • Unplug the charger from electrical outlets and the device when not in use.
  • Do not use, store or transport the device where flammables or explosives are stored (in a gas station, oil depot, or chemical plant, for example). Using your device in these environments increases the risk of explosion or fire.
  • Keep the battery away from fire, and do not disassemble, modify, throw, or squeeze it. Do not insert foreign objects into it, submerge it in water or other liquids, or expose it to external force or pressure, as this may cause the battery to leak, overheat, catch fire, or even explode.
  • Dispose of this device, the battery, and accessories according to local regulations. They should not be disposed of in normal household waste. Improper battery use may lead to fire, explosion, or other hazards.
  • This device contains a built-in battery. Do not attempt to replace the battery by yourself. Otherwise, the device may not run properly or it may damage the battery. For your personal safety and to ensure that your device runs properly, you are strongly advised to contact a Huawei-authorized service center for a replacement.
  • Ensure that the power adapter meets the requirements of Annex Q of IEC/EN 62368-1 and has been tested and approved according to national or local standards.

RF Exposure Information
The World Health Organization has stated that exposure can be reduced by limiting your usage or simply using a hands-free kit to keep the device away from the head and body.
Ensure that the device accessories, such as a device case and device holster, are not composed of metal components. Keep the device away from your body to meet the distance requirement.

For the countries that adopted the SAR limit of 2.0 W/kg over 10 grams of tissue.
The device complies with RF specifications when used near your ear or at a distance of 0.50 cm from your body. The highest reported SAR value: Head SAR: 0.87 W/kg; body SAR: 1.24 W/kg.
